The University of Exeter is a Russell Group university that combines world-class research with very high levels of student satisfaction. Exeter has over 21,000 students from more than 130 different countries and is in the top 1% of universities in the world with 98% of its research rated as being of international quality. Our research focuses on some of the most fundamental issues facing humankind today. Fifty percent of our organisation is made up of Professional Services support staff that partner closely with the Academic colleges to ensure we achieve our strategy and vision.

This part-time post (0.65 FTE) is available on a fixed-term basis until 31 July 2018.

This is an exciting opportunity for a Work Placement Coordinator to join the Student Employability and Academic Success (SEAS) Team. The post will specifically support the development of work placements and projects for students on the MA Translation Studies programme.

The successful candidate will be adept at building professional relationships with a range of external organisations. With excellent verbal and written communication skills, they will be a strong negotiator who is able to build and sustain contacts at a regional, national and international level. The prospect of working directly with staff and students on the MA Translation Studies programme should also excite you, since the post plays an important role in developing the programme. Strong administrative and IT skills are also required, combined with the ability to pay excellent attention to detail.
